What are the 4 main sociocultural factors?
Life events, urbanicity, social isolation, ethnicity and discrimination
What is life events?
Stressful traumatic life events been suggest to trigger onset of SZ, reason is unknown, linked to changes in NT levels in brain
What did brown and birley find?
50% experienced major life event 3 weeks before s episode, 12% 9weeks prior
What is urbanicity?
Urban living doesn’t suit evolutionary traits of humans, explain higher rates of MH disorders, increase of social stress could trigger SZ
What did Van os et al find?
An increase in incidence of schizophrenia in people born in urban areas
How do social isolation cause SZ?
Individual doesn’t get feedback on inappropriate thoughts and behaviours they have so nuture them and become resistant to change. Symptoms go unnoticed for long
What did Jones et al find?
Longitudinal study, 5362, 30 cases diagnosed, more likely to show solitary play at 4 and 6 and at 13 rate themselves less socially confident
